EPA emphasizes vulnerabilities water utilities face in wake of Pennsylvania hack impacting industrial control systems
The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ency is highlighting the importance of water utilities investing in basic cybersecurity measures, following a hack earlier this week to programmable logic controllers used by the Municipal Water Authority of Aliquippa in Pennsylvania.
“EPA believes that water utilities, which provide drinking water and wastewater services that are essential to public health, need to incorporate cybersecurity measures into their operations and planning to reduce the risk of hacking from foreign and domestic actors,” EPA spokesperson Remmington Belford...
